Analysis

In 2024, proportion of population using at least basic sanitation services in Tonga stood at 93.93. That is the highest value across all 25 years on record.

That represents a change of up 1.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, proportion of population using at least basic sanitation services in Tonga peaked at 93.93 in 2024 and was at its lowest, 89.19, in 2000.

That places Tonga 119th out of 231 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 25 years of available data.
